Output 3c93650152e81a42d154aecc5666a6e2e1716af32155d87e386621f2e9bf0e1a:1

value
85845
script pubkey
OP_HASH160 OP_PUSHBYTES_20 684c4f7b4eb1ca335f27dbd19daa5ae704157f60 OP_EQUAL
address
3BCVce1VBivGDyhcNaGMM7EZ2b5BZwPoPF
transaction
3c93650152e81a42d154aecc5666a6e2e1716af32155d87e386621f2e9bf0e1a